Specs at a Glance
| Feature | iPhone 13 | 11 Pro |
|---|---|---|
| Display Size | 6.1-inch | 5.8-inch |
| Chip | A15 Bionic | A13 Bionic |
| Main Camera | 12MP Dual-camera | 12MP Triple-camera |
| Video Recording | 4K Dolby Vision HDR | 4K up to 60 fps |
| Front Camera | 12MP | 12MP |
| RAM | 4GB | 4GB |
| Storage Options | 128GB, 256GB, 512GB | 64GB, 256GB, 512GB |
| Battery Life | Up to 19 hours video playback | Up to 18 hours video playback |
| 5G Connectivity | Yes | No |
| Water Resistance | IP68 | IP68 |
| Weight | 174g | 188g |
| Display Technology | Super Retina XDR | Super Retina XDR |
Feature-by-Feature Breakdown
Display
- iPhone 13: Features a 6.1-inch Super Retina XDR display, offering vibrant colors and improved brightness. It’s great for media consumption and daily use. However, it still lacks the ProMotion 120Hz refresh rate.
- 11 Pro: Boasts a 5.8-inch Super Retina XDR display, known for its excellent color accuracy and contrast. The smaller size might appeal to some, but it has a lower peak brightness than the iPhone 13.
- Winner: iPhone 13
Processor
- iPhone 13: Powered by the A15 Bionic chip, delivering significantly improved performance and efficiency. This results in faster app launches, smoother multitasking, and better graphics performance.
- 11 Pro: Equipped with the A13 Bionic chip, which is still a capable processor, but shows its age when compared to the A15. It handles most tasks well but can feel less responsive than the iPhone 13.
- Winner: iPhone 13
Camera System
- iPhone 13: Features a dual 12MP camera system with sensor-shift optical image stabilization. Offers improved low-light performance, Cinematic mode for video, and Photographic Styles for personalized photo editing.
- 11 Pro: Has a triple 12MP camera system, providing greater versatility with its telephoto lens. Delivers excellent image quality, but lags behind the iPhone 13 in terms of low-light performance and video features.
- Winner: iPhone 13
Battery Life
- iPhone 13: Offers noticeably improved battery life compared to the 11 Pro. Easily lasts a full day with moderate to heavy usage, making it a reliable choice for long days.
- 11 Pro: Provides decent battery life, but it can struggle to last a full day with heavy use. Users may need to charge it more frequently compared to the iPhone 13.
- Winner: iPhone 13
Design
- iPhone 13: Features a flat-edged design with a smaller notch. Offers a more modern look and feel. Comes in a variety of colors.
- 11 Pro: Maintains the familiar rounded-edge design. It is a stylish phone, but it is not as modern as the iPhone 13.
- Winner: iPhone 13
Storage Options
- iPhone 13: Available with a base storage of 128GB, with options up to 512GB. Provides ample space for photos, videos, and apps.
- 11 Pro: Starts at 64GB, with options up to 512GB. The base storage is smaller than the iPhone 13, which may require users to manage their storage more carefully.
- Winner: iPhone 13
Video Recording
- iPhone 13: Introduces Cinematic mode, offering shallow depth of field effects in video. Also offers improved video stabilization and low-light video performance.
- 11 Pro: Offers excellent video recording capabilities with 4K at 60fps. Lacks the Cinematic mode and some of the advanced video features of the iPhone 13.
- Winner: iPhone 13
Price
- iPhone 13: Generally, the newer model at a higher price point, dependent on storage.
- 11 Pro: Often available at a lower price point, especially used or refurbished, offering a more budget-friendly option.
- Winner: 11 Pro

iPhone 13 vs 11 Pro Buying Guide
Performance
The iPhone 13 boasts the A15 Bionic chip, offering a significant performance leap compared to the A13 Bionic in the iPhone 11 Pro. This translates to faster app loading, smoother multitasking, and improved gaming experiences. The A15 Bionic features a more advanced Neural Engine, enhancing machine learning capabilities for tasks like image processing and Siri responsiveness. While the 11 Pro is still capable, the 13 provides a noticeable edge in overall speed and efficiency, making it the better choice for demanding users.
Camera
The iPhone 13’s camera system incorporates improvements such as sensor-shift optical image stabilization, which delivers steadier photos and videos. It also features a larger sensor that captures more light, resulting in enhanced low-light performance. Photographic Styles, introduced with the iPhone 13, allow for personalized image adjustments. The 11 Pro’s triple-camera system remains competent, but the 13 offers superior image quality and a more refined user experience, particularly in challenging lighting conditions.
Display
The iPhone 13 features a brighter display, improving outdoor visibility. While both phones feature OLED screens, the 13’s display offers a slightly higher peak brightness and improved color accuracy. The 11 Pro’s display is still excellent, providing vibrant colors and deep blacks. However, the iPhone 13’s display enhancements contribute to a more immersive viewing experience, especially when watching videos or playing games in bright environments. This small difference can be significant for users who spend a lot of time on their phone.
Battery Life
The iPhone 13 offers noticeably improved battery life compared to the 11 Pro. The 13’s more efficient chip and larger battery capacity translate to longer usage times, potentially allowing users to get through a full day of heavy use without needing to recharge. The 11 Pro’s battery life is still reasonable, but the 13 provides a significant advantage, particularly for users who value extended battery performance. This is a crucial factor for many users, and the 13 clearly excels in this area.
Design and Build Quality
Both phones feature premium designs with durable materials. The iPhone 13 has a slightly updated design with flatter edges and a smaller notch. The 11 Pro has a more classic design. Both phones are water-resistant and feature a similar build quality. The iPhone 13’s design is more modern, while the 11 Pro offers a familiar aesthetic. Ultimately, the choice depends on personal preference, as both phones are well-built and feel premium in hand. The design difference is subtle but noticeable.
Price and Value
The iPhone 13, being the newer model, typically carries a higher price tag than a used or refurbished iPhone 11 Pro. However, the performance enhancements, camera improvements, and extended battery life of the iPhone 13 justify the price difference for many users. The 11 Pro offers excellent value, especially if purchased used, but the 13 provides a more future-proof experience. Consider your budget and desired features to determine which phone offers the best value for your needs.
Who Should Buy What?
Buy iPhone 13 If…
- You want the latest A15 Bionic chip for improved performance.
- You desire 5G connectivity for faster download and streaming speeds.
- You prefer longer battery life.
- You want a slightly larger display.
Buy 11 Pro If…
- You want a phone with a telephoto lens for optical zoom capabilities.
- You prioritize a smaller, more compact design.
- You can find it at a significantly reduced price.
- You prefer a phone with a matte finish on the back.
